I present to you, the first ever Glossybox in Australia! I was sent the box for review purposes.
If you're not already familiar with how these monthly subscription beauty boxes work, take a look here. It explains everything you need to know :)
It's so true that first impressions count. From the moment I saw the box, it was a positive experience. Gorgeous box, sufficient information and packed with care. What stood out to me the most however, was not only the pretty packaging, but the partner brands of Glossybox. I can say I know more than 90% of the brands and that somewhat makes my interest for this box a lot more higher than being sent a box full of samples of brands I've never heard of. I know in a previous review, I mentioned it's great to be able to try new brands to experiment but I can't help but be excited when I see some of my favourite brands such as Shiseido, Shu Uemura, YSL, Illamasqua, Jurlique etc.

So here's a picture of what was inside the November Glossybox.
There is a very handy card that explains what products you've received, how much it can be purchased for and some information on each item. Apart from the 5 products, included in this box was a 15% off Jurlique products storewide card! Woo now I can go and buy my HG Rose Silk Powder! Oh and pink jellybeans!! I demolished them as soon as I opened them. Lollies = win.
I've become a little more familiar with the Bio-Oil and Mirenesse products, thanks to ABBW. I've started using the oil and so far so good so to have a back up is perfect! Which girl can have too many lip glosses? The Mirenesse lipgloss is a red colour called 'Geisha'. A great pair with the Essie nail polish.
One more thing - I love that I can reuse the Glossybox for storage!
